نمایش نتایج 1 تا 9 از 9

نام تاپیک: ساختن گالری عکس

  1. #1
    کاربر دائمی آواتار یاسر مددیان
    تاریخ عضویت
    شهریور 1385
    محل زندگی
    سرزمین پارس
    پست
    385

    ساختن گالری عکس

    سلام
    من می خوام تو سایتم گالری عکس بذارم به صورتی که مدیر بتونه گالری تعریف کنه. با ساختن گالری مشکلی ندارم .
    ابتدا مدیر گالری رو تعریف می کنه و عکس ها رو به اون نسبت میده. حالا کاربر که وارد سایت میشه روی گالری مورد نظر کلیک می کنه و در صفحه بعد عکس های مورد نظر رو می بینه.

    مشکل من اینجاست که چه جوری تو صفحه نمایش عکس ها ، عکس ها رو تو 4 ستون نمایش بدم ؟ باید از 4 تا datalist یا datagrid استفاده کنم یا یکی ؟


    اگه کمک کنید ممنون می شم.



    با تشکر.

  2. #2
    یک UserControl بسازید که 4 تا عکس رو نشون بده ، مثلا بهش ID عکس اول اون 4 تا عکس رو بدید و اون خودش 4 تا رو تشخیص و نشون بده ، حالا این UserControl رو توی یک گرید با Paging مثلا 1 بزارید.
    به این ترتیب دست شما برای نمایش 4 تایی به هر صورتی که می خواید باز خواهد بود

    موفق باشید

  3. #3
    ساختار نمایش رو با استفاده از یک تگ Table ایجاد کن و قسمت هایی که تکرار میشن رو در Repeater قرار بده.

    موفق باشید.

  4. #4
    کاربر دائمی آواتار یاسر مددیان
    تاریخ عضویت
    شهریور 1385
    محل زندگی
    سرزمین پارس
    پست
    385
    خوب من الان یه Table تعریف می کنم با 4 ستون ، بعد بیام تو هر سلول یه repeater بزارم ؟
    یا اینکه به صورت پویا Table تعریف کنم؟
    اگه یه خورده بیشتر توضیح بدین ممنون میشم.

  5. #5
    فرض کن تو الان ساختار جدول رو درست کردی.
    اون چیزی که نیازه تکرار بشه، ردیف ها هستند.
    نیاز داری تا TR ها رو در یک Repeater قرار بدی.
    پس 4 TD داری و یک TR که مقادیر این TD ها که نام عکس ها هستند از دیتابیس استخراج میشه و اونها رو با Eval به خاصیت ImageUrl یک Image نسبت میدی.

    ?any Problem

  6. #6
    با سلام
    میشه هم DataList استفاده کنید.
    یه پراپرتی به نام ...Column داره که میتونه تمپلیت شما رو در تعدا ستونی که بهش میدین
    تکرار کنه
    بگردین حتما پیدا میکنید .
    در این سایت هم من استفاده کرده ام : http://www.fanoos-system.com/Default.aspx?id=2
    اون محصولات که میبینید یک تمپلیت براشون تعریف شده که خود DataList در سه تا ستون جداشون میکنه

    موفق باشید .

  7. #7
    کاربر دائمی آواتار یاسر مددیان
    تاریخ عضویت
    شهریور 1385
    محل زندگی
    سرزمین پارس
    پست
    385
    نقل قول نوشته شده توسط Behrouz_Rad مشاهده تاپیک
    فرض کن تو الان ساختار جدول رو درست کردی.
    اون چیزی که نیازه تکرار بشه، ردیف ها هستند.
    نیاز داری تا TR ها رو در یک Repeater قرار بدی.
    پس 4 TD داری و یک TR که مقادیر این TD ها که نام عکس ها هستند از دیتابیس استخراج میشه و اونها رو با Eval به خاصیت ImageUrl یک Image نسبت میدی.

    ?any Problem

    ممنون آقای راد
    گاهی اوقات هم آدم قاطی می کنه. شرمنده. من هنوز این و پیاده نکردم . از اول هم همین به فکرم زد ولی یه کم پرت رفته بودم. به هر حال ممنونم.

  8. #8
    کاربر دائمی آواتار یاسر مددیان
    تاریخ عضویت
    شهریور 1385
    محل زندگی
    سرزمین پارس
    پست
    385
    نقل قول نوشته شده توسط Chabok مشاهده تاپیک
    با سلام
    میشه هم DataList استفاده کنید.
    یه پراپرتی به نام ...Column داره که میتونه تمپلیت شما رو در تعدا ستونی که بهش میدین
    تکرار کنه
    بگردین حتما پیدا میکنید .
    در این سایت هم من استفاده کرده ام : http://www.fanoos-system.com/Default.aspx?id=2
    اون محصولات که میبینید یک تمپلیت براشون تعریف شده که خود DataList در سه تا ستون جداشون میکنه

    موفق باشید .

    ممنون از راهنماییت.
    کارت خیلی قشنگ بود. از Ajax استفاده کردی درسته ؟

  9. #9
    با سلام
    راستش از همه چیز استفاده کرده ام بجز Ajax .
    کجاش توجه شما رو جلب کرد ؟

    در ضمن بگم مشکل شما صد در صد با این روش حل میشه و بسیار راحت است .
    پیدا کردین اون پراپرتی مربوط به DataList رو که خودش ستون بندی میکنه ؟
    برای این کار از این سه ویژگی استفاده کنید .
    RepeatColumns
    RepeatDirection
    RepeatLayout

    موفق باشید .

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•